Eight Legs - These Grey Days

Eight Legs on Weekender have a 7"/CDs out called These Grey Days and it's more of that chirpy handy sounding indie. The Guitars sound like early Orange Juice... it's got a very classic indie sound....I've heard so much of this stuff lately I have no idea what else I could possibly say about it.

Eight Legs are an all male 4 piece (hence the name) still in or barely out of their teens now based in London. This is the penultimate release before the band release their debut album, Searching For The Simple Life, set for Feb 08.
This is their 3rd single with Weekender and they were 2006’s Christian Dior band (the previous 3 were Beck, Razorlight and The Rakes) which included touring Brazil early 07. They have built up a good following through heavy touring including a German tour with The Pigeon Detectives in September 07.
The album was released in Japan in Sept 07 on Kurofone/Handcuts initially shipping in excess of 2,500 copies, they will tour there in November/December.
Produced by John Fortis (Razorlight) on the a side and Brian O’Shaughnessy on the b side (Primal Scream) the tracks are the rare combination of youthful energy and mature wordplay.
